The War on Trump Continues

If the country was in good health politically it would be fine to have a heated primary. We are not.
12 Jun 2023 ~~ By Brian T. Kennedy

We are living in a political war the likes of which this country has never seen. Politics is always filled with lies and deceit. This is something different. The society-wide use of political narratives, gaslighting, and disinformation designed to confuse and disorient the American people is unprecedented. Now add to this the indictment of President Donald Trump on charges relating to classified documents—documents he had the unilateral constitutional authority to declassify at his own discretion—and we see the weaponization of government taken to new lows.
Let us first state the obvious. The presidency of Donald Trump revealed to the American people the corruption of our ruling class with striking clarity. Trump also revealed the nature of our enemies abroad. Because President Trump had the courage to stand up against both the political and financial elites who run the United States and the malfeasance of the Chinese Communist Party, a war was waged against his presidency, the American people, and our way of life.
For millions of Americans who believe in liberty and who believe this country can be saved—namely, the MAGA movement—Trump embodies the manly principles of independence. These Americans want Trump to be president again.

The War Against Trump

That Trump would even run for president again seems fanciful. The Durham report released in May reveals an American intelligence community that was well organized and determined to advance a sophisticated disinformation campaign against him. This campaign was not unlike those the U.S. government runs against foreign enemies of the United States. As a matter of high government policy, the Obama Administration disseminated falsehoods about Trump and the Russian government to undermine his chances of winning in 2016 and, after he won anyway, to bring down his presidency and undermine the political agenda for which he was elected.
These were not rogue actors behaving contrary to agency policy. These were the leaders of the intelligence community from CIA Director John Brennan, Director of National Intelligence James Clapper, FBI Director James Comey, and Attorney General Loretta Lynch. They established among intelligence operatives, the large number of so-called journalists that fancy themselves part of their apparatus, and members of Congress like Adam Schiff (D-Calif.) the false narrative that Donald Trump was somehow a traitor to his country.
